What does the "W" stand for in the course numbers?
WritingLinks at UNLV -- University of Nevada, Las VegasThe "W" stands for "Writing Link." Any course designated with a "W" at the end of the course number will be the same as the one described in the Undergraduate Catalog (e.g., ENG 101W is the same as ENG 101), except that it is part of the Writing Links program and, we feel, enhanced by virture of its being linked to another course.

What must I do if I receive an incomplete grade?
Frequently Asked Questions - FIU College of Business Adminis...Students should contact their professors immediately to determine what needs to be done to earn a final grade. Students have two terms, including summer, to make up the missing work. After one calendar year, the professor can no longer change a student's grade without permission from the vice president of the university.

What happens if I or my dependents do not receive a grade of "B" or better?
Division of Human Resources - Frequently Asked QuestionsThe University will make payroll deductions for six (6) biweekly pay periods to reimburse the cost of the course(s). The University Cashier's Office will determine the amount of the deduction based on the courses involved. The biweekly deductions will begin approximately three (3) weeks after grades are submitted. The University will deduct the remaining amount from the employee's final paycheck or from any other funds due the employee.

What all languages are available on the "day wheel" of the Day-Date "President"?
Rolex Frequently Asked Questions... QualityTyme.netThe "day wheel" on the Day-Date is available in the following 26 languages: English, German, Arabic, Chinese, Danish, Spanish, Basque, Catalan, Ethiopian, Finnish, French, Greek, Hebrew, Dutch, Indonesian, Italian, Japanese, Latin, Moroccan, Norwegian, Farsi, Polish, Portuguese, Russian, Swedish and Turkish.
